Here, we look at some of the top causes of poverty around the world.

Inadequate access to clean water and nutritious food. ...

Little or no access to livelihoods or jobs. ...

Conflict. ...

Inequality. ...

Poor education. ...

Climate change. ...

Lack of infrastructure. ...

Limited capacity of the government.
